API 6A Cameron 2-1/16 5000psi Fls Hydraulic Type Gate Valve

The API 6A Cameron 2-1/16 5000psi Fls Hydraulic Type Gate Valve is a robust high-pressure solution designed for oil and gas drilling, industrial fluid control, and harsh environments. Built with customizable materials and manual/hydraulic operation capabilities, it ensures reliability under extreme conditions.
